Honor Defense Announces New LE Versions of the Honor Guard

USA -(Ammoland.com)- Responding to requests from law enforcement, Honor Defense is proud to announce two new Honor Guard versions specifically designed for backup and off duty use by police personnel. Both pistols will also be available for commercial use.

The new HG9CLE and the HG9CLEMS (manual safety) pistols feature 3.8-inch barrels on a stainless-steel modular chassis. Like the other commercial models, the pistol is assembled with 100 percent USA parts and materials.

The stainless-steel slide and barrel both feature a ferritic nitro-carburized finish and designed to handle +P ammunition.

Both the HG9CLE and the HG9CLEMS come with two eight round magazines – and two backstraps to fit a variety of hand sizes. While other brands use plastic striker housings, Honor Defense utilizes stainless-steel striker housing with an integrated striker block for safety.

Both pistols are completely ambidextrous for easy manipulation by both left- or right-hand Officers, or one-handed operation if necessary.

“Honor Defense pistols have been developed for professional use and both models will also be available to civilians. We will begin to ship these models prior to the 2017 NRA Show,” said Gary Ramey, President of Honor Defense. “We are proud that several police departments have recently approved the Honor Defense pistols for use by Officers as backup and off-duty handguns.”

Specs:

  • Overall Length: 6.8″
  • Barrel Length: 3.8″
  • Weight: 25 oz.
  • Height: 4.6″
  • Width: .96″
  • Barrel: Stainless Steel
  • Chassis: Stainless-steel Modular
  • Slide: Stainless Steel
  • Slide and Barrel Finish: Ferritic Nitro-Carburized
  • Twist: 1:10″ RH
